Understanding Coarse Pore Silica Gel
Coarse pore silica gel, often designated as Type C, is characterized by a wider pore diameter and a larger pore volume compared to its fine-pored counterparts like Type A. This unique structure allows it to effectively adsorb moisture even at higher relative humidity levels, and it is also adept at adsorbing larger organic molecules. Its physical form can be spherical or blocky, with common particle sizes ranging from 2-5mm and 4-8mm. Its enhanced adsorption capacity and specific structural advantages make it ideal for applications where standard desiccants might saturate too quickly or be less effective.
Key Applications for Coarse Pore Silica Gel
The robust adsorption properties of coarse pore silica gel lend themselves to several critical industrial applications:
- Industrial Gas Drying: It is highly effective in drying various industrial gases where moisture content can be significant, ensuring the purity and operational integrity of gas streams.
- Adsorption of Organic Acids and Moisture: Particularly useful in petrochemical applications, it can efficiently adsorb organic acids and moisture from transformer oils and other industrial fluids.
- Catalyst Carriers: Its large pore structure makes it an excellent carrier for catalysts, especially in processes involving larger molecules or requiring higher adsorption capacities.
- Purification and Separation: It plays a role in the purification and separation of specific components in industrial processes, including the removal of polyvalent harmful elements from water.
- Fine Chemical Production: Serves as a base material for further processing into other specialized silica gel products.
